Ty Reagan Obituary
Lawrence Tyler "Ty" Reagan, age 57, of Douglasville, Georgia, passed away on Friday, January 30, 2026. He was born on May 19, 1968, in Atlanta, Georgia, to Joe and Wanda Reagan. Ty worked for many years at McMaster-Carr and was a faithful member... Read Ty Reagan's Obituary
